Brown & Red Spot Reduction
Reduction of discolored spots on the body can be achieved using various wavelengths of laser light applied in a controlled and measured manner of destruction. More than one treatment is usually required to achieve the desired clearance of unwanted cosmetic discoloration. Intense Pulse Light (IPL) lasers are typically used to perform these types of treatments. However, we also use our PiQo4 laser to remove seborrheic keratosis (dark brown lesions) on the skin.

Moxi® is a gentle, yet powerful, 1927nm fractionated laser designed with everyone in mind, ideal for patients who want to delay the appearance of aging or those looking to maintain beautiful skin with little to no downtime or discomfort. In a quick eight-to-ten-minute procedure, Moxi® comfortably delivers non-ablative laser energy to correct the initial signs of sun damage and aging, regardless of skin type, for a glowing and clear complexion.

Moxi® and BBL® together are a powerful combination treatment for addressing the appearance of aging in all skin types. These two laser therapies can be done during the same visit and the recovery time for both procedures overlaps, reducing the overall downtime. The results from this combinatorial therapy show maximal benefits regarding skin discoloration, skin tone and texture after a single treatment. Optimal results are obtained following a series of three treatments allowing 4 weeks between each procedure.

The PiQo4 is an advanced FDA-cleared laser designed for benign pigmented lesion clearance. The laser combines both picosecond (trillionth of a second) and nanosecond (billionth of a second) pulse durations, allowing breakdown of pigments into extremely small particles that can be easily reabsorbed into the body. The high power of the PiQo4 enable pigment removal from a wide variety of skin tones with fewer treatments.
